Removal and Installation

  1. With the vehicle in NEUTRAL, position it on a hoist. For additional information, refer to JACKING & LIFTING .
  2. Remove and discard the roll restrictor cross brace-to-roll restrictor bolt.
    • To install, tighten to 48 N.m (35 lb-ft).

  3. Remove the front transaxle stabilizer bolt and nut.
    • To install, tighten to 40 N.m (30 lb-ft).

  4. If equipped, remove the 3 bolts and the LH exhaust manifold heat shield.
    • To install, tighten to 11 N.m (8 lb-ft).
  5. Remove the engine support insulator lower nut.
    • To install, tighten to 70 N.m (52 lb-ft).
  6. Remove the engine support insulator upper nut.
    • To install, tighten to 70 N.m (52 lb-ft).
  7. Mount the special tool to the LH cylinder head.

  8. Using the special tools, raise the engine to gain the clearance necessary to remove the insulator.

  9. CAUTION: Make sure that the engine support insulator locator pins are aligned correctly with the bracket.
  10. To install, reverse the removal procedure.
